TYRE PRESSURE LOSS WARNING (1/3)
When fitted to the vehicle, this system 
notifies the driver if one or more tyres 
lose pressure.

LANE DEPARTURE WARNING (1/2)
This lane departure warning system no-
tifies the driver when they accidentally 
cross a continuous or broken line.

The cruise control function helps you to 
maintain your driving speed at a speed 
that you choose, called the cruising 
speed.
This cruising speed may be set at any 
speed above 20 mph (30 km/h).
